Looks great with the KW springs! Stunning wheels as well!

I had the adjustable KW springs on an 2017 RS6 before, and the car was not driving well anymore. Too soft in comfort (rolling over in corners) and far too hard in dynamic mode. Hard is not the right word, because I am used to hard / stiff cars, but this car was jumping al the time, really annoying, it made passengers sick. Don't you experience this with the KW springs on the M8?

Now I have an M8 Competition (coupe) and want to lower it. Even after my bad experience with the RS6 I am considering the KW springs or the KW V4 full kit. Does anyone have experience with the full kit of dampers and springs? It cost a lot more and if you install it, the comfort, sport and sport plus suspension modes won't work anymore. Curious to find out if somebody has used this set.
